Página InicialGruposDiscussãoMaisZeitgeist
Pesquisar O Sítio Web
Este sítio web usa «cookies» para fornecer os seus serviços, para melhorar o desempenho, para analítica e (se não estiver autenticado) para publicidade. Ao usar o LibraryThing está a reconhecer que leu e compreende os nossos Termos de Serviço e Política de Privacidade. A sua utilização deste sítio e serviços está sujeita a essas políticas e termos.
Hide this

Resultados dos Livros Google

Carregue numa fotografia para ir para os Livros Google.

Joe Celko's SQL for Smarties: Advanced…
A carregar...

Joe Celko's SQL for Smarties: Advanced SQL Programming (The Morgan… (edição 2010)

por Joe Celko (Autor)

MembrosCríticasPopularidadeAvaliação médiaDiscussões
94Nenhum(a)223,201 (4)Nenhum(a)
SQL for Smarties was hailed as the first book devoted explicitly to the advanced techniques needed to transform an experienced SQL programmer into an expert. Now, 10 years later and in the third edition, this classic still reigns supreme as the book written by an SQL master that teaches future SQL masters. These are not just tips and techniques; Joe also offers the best solutions to old and new challenges and conveys the way you need to think in order to get the most out of SQL programming efforts for both correctness and performance. In the third edition, Joe features new examples and updates to SQL-99, expanded sections of Query techniques, and a new section on schema design, with the same war-story teaching style that made the first and second editions of this book classics.… (mais)
Membro:Rekidiang
Título:Joe Celko's SQL for Smarties: Advanced SQL Programming (The Morgan Kaufmann Series in Data Management Systems)
Autores:Joe Celko (Autor)
Informação:Morgan Kaufmann (2010), Edition: 4, 817 pages
Colecções:A sua biblioteca
Avaliação:
Etiquetas:Nenhum(a)

Pormenores da obra

Joe Celko's SQL for Smarties: Advanced SQL Programming, Third Edition por Joe Celko

  1. 00
    An introduction to database systems por C. J. Date (PlaidStallion)
    PlaidStallion: From exercise: 8.12 Give as many SQL formulations as you can think of for the query “Get supplier names for suppliers who supply part P2”

    Here are a few such formulations. Note that the following list isn’t even close to being exhaustive [4.19]. Note too that this is a very simple query!

    SELECT DISTINCT S.SNAME
    FROM S
    WHERE S.S# IN
    ( SELECT SP.S#
    FROM SP
    WHERE SP.P# = P#('P2') ) ;

    SELECT DISTINCT T.SNAME
    FROM ( S NATURAL JOIN SP ) AS T
    WHERE T.P# = P#('P2') ;

    SELECT DISTINCT T.SNAME
    FROM ( S JOIN SP ON S.S# = SP.P# AND SP.P# = P#('P2') ) AS T ;

    SELECT DISTINCT T.SNAME
    FROM ( S JOIN SP USING S# ) AS T
    WHERE T.P# = P#('P2') ;

    SELECT DISTINCT S.SNAME
    FROM S
    WHERE EXISTS
    ( SELECT *
    FROM SP
    WHERE SP.S# = S.S#
    AND SP.P# = P#('P2') ) ;

    SELECT DISTINCT S.SNAME
    FROM S, SP
    WHERE S.S# = SP.S#
    AND SP.P# = P#('P2') ;

    SELECT DISTINCT S.SNAME
    FROM S
    WHERE 0 <
    ( SELECT COUNT(*)
    FROM SP
    WHERE SP.S# = S.S#
    AND SP.P# = P#('P2') ) ;

    SELECT DISTINCT S.SNAME
    FROM S
    WHERE P#('P2') IN
    ( SELECT SP.P#
    FROM SP
    WHERE SP.S# = S.S# ) ;

    SELECT S.SNAME
    FROM S, SP
    WHERE S.S# = SP.S#
    AND SP.P# = P#('P2')
    GROUP BY S.SNAME ;

    Subsidiary question: What are the implications of the foregoing? Answer: The language is harder to document, teach, learn, remember, use, and implement efficiently, than it ought to be.
    … (mais)
Nenhum(a)
A carregar...

Adira ao LibraryThing para descobrir se irá gostar deste livro.

Ainda não há conversas na Discussão sobre este livro.

Sem críticas
sem críticas | adicionar uma crítica
Tem de autenticar-se para poder editar dados do Conhecimento Comum.
Para mais ajuda veja a página de ajuda do Conhecimento Comum.
Título canónico
Informação do Conhecimento Comum em inglês. Edite para a localizar na sua língua.
Título original
Títulos alternativos
Data da publicação original
Pessoas/Personagens
Locais importantes
Acontecimentos importantes
Filmes relacionados
Prémios e menções honrosas
Epígrafe
Dedicatória
Primeiras palavras
Citações
Últimas palavras
Nota de desambiguação
Editores da Editora
Autores de citações elogiosas (normalmente na contracapa do livro)
Língua original
DDC/MDS canónico

Referências a esta obra em recursos externos.

Wikipédia em inglês

Nenhum(a)

SQL for Smarties was hailed as the first book devoted explicitly to the advanced techniques needed to transform an experienced SQL programmer into an expert. Now, 10 years later and in the third edition, this classic still reigns supreme as the book written by an SQL master that teaches future SQL masters. These are not just tips and techniques; Joe also offers the best solutions to old and new challenges and conveys the way you need to think in order to get the most out of SQL programming efforts for both correctness and performance. In the third edition, Joe features new examples and updates to SQL-99, expanded sections of Query techniques, and a new section on schema design, with the same war-story teaching style that made the first and second editions of this book classics.

Não foram encontradas descrições de bibliotecas.

Descrição do livro
Resumo Haiku

Ligações Rápidas

Capas populares

Nenhum(a)

Avaliação

Média: (4)
0.5
1
1.5
2 1
2.5
3 1
3.5
4 7
4.5
5 3

É você?

Torne-se num Autor LibraryThing.

 

Acerca | Contacto | LibraryThing.com | Privacidade/Termos | Ajuda/Perguntas Frequentes | Blogue | Loja | APIs | TinyCat | Bibliotecas Legadas | Primeiros Críticos | Conhecimento Comum | 157,853,162 livros! | Barra de topo: Sempre visível